About Ross A. Kerner

Ross A. Kerner is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Polymers and Plastics, Electronic, Optical and Magnetic Materials and Atomic and Molecular Physics, and Optics, having authored 53 papers that have together received 5.3k indexed citations. Recurring topics across this work include Perovskite Materials and Applications (46 papers), Quantum Dots Synthesis And Properties (19 papers), Chalcogenide Semiconductor Thin Films (14 papers), Conducting polymers and applications (11 papers), Solid-state spectroscopy and crystallography (11 papers), Organic Light-Emitting Diodes Research (7 papers), Organic and Molecular Conductors Research (6 papers) and Organic Electronics and Photovoltaics (5 papers). The work is most often cited by research in Polymers and Plastics (1.6k citations), Electrical and Electronic Engineering (5.1k citations), Materials Chemistry (3.3k citations), Acoustics and Ultrasonics (53 citations) and Atomic and Molecular Physics, and Optics (485 citations). Ross A. Kerner has collaborated with scholars based in United States, Israel and China. Frequent co-authors include Barry P. Rand, Lianfeng Zhao, Zhengguo Xiao, Gregory D. Scholes, Joseph J. Berry, Tae‐Wook Koh, Kyung Min Lee, Noel C. Giebink, Alex J. Grede and Yufei Jia. Their work appears in journals such as ACS Energy Letters, The Journal of Physical Chemistry Letters, Joule, Journal of Materials Chemistry C and Applied Physics Letters.
